The National Assembly approved nine letters on different topics in it a session on Tuesday. Among the topics was a letter from head of the parliamentary committee on health and social affairs MP Talal AlJalal, requesting extension of the committee’s work period to submit a report on the safety of using 5G network, regarding people and the environment.
Also, head of the parliamentary committee for youth and sport MP Nabeel AlFadhil requested extension to investigate monetary and administrative violations, to submit the final report by end of August.
The assembly also approved a letter from MP Yousef AlFadhala, where he called on the Cabinet to grant rewards not only for those who worked in the frontlines to fight the coronavirus, but for everyone who worked during this crisis.
The other letters included tasking the parliamentary committee on human resources with presenting a report on evaluating senior officials and extending work period for internal affairs and defense committee to present a report on traffic.
Moreover, it included the report of legislative and legal committee amendments on work in the oil sector and retasking the public utilities committee with presenting a report on food security within two months.
